Inspection History
Feb 1, 2024
Routine
3 major violations. 1 minor violation.
View 4 violations
(a) equipment food-contact surfaces nonfood-contact surfaces and utensils (pf)
Inspector notes: Interior of ice machine with pink mold-like substance. Clean and maintain.
590.004/4-601.11-PF
Clean-up of vomiting and diarrheal events (pf)
Inspector notes: No clean-up kit on site. Procedures provided.
590.002/2-501.11-PF
Sanitizing solutions testing devices (pf)
Inspector notes: No test strips for quats sanitizer. Provide test strips
590.004/4-302.14-PF
(a) certified food protection manager (c)
Inspector notes: No certified person on staff. Provide certification if necessary for menu
590.002(C)/2-102.12-C
